BALLOONAGH, TRALEE, CO KERRY
Retention of a change of use from a retirement home to an outpatient healthcare facility in Tralee.

Development description
Change of use from retirement/nursing home/ family centre to an outpatient healthcare facility providing team bases, clinical spaces and office accommodation
